Ingredients
- 1 cup salted butter, softened
- 3/4 cup brown sugar
- 3/4 cup granulated sugar
- 1 and 1/2 tsp vanilla extract
- 2 large eggs
- 3 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 tsp baking soda
- 1 tsp baking powder
- 1/4 tsp salt
- 1 and 1/2 cups semi-sweet chocolate chips
- 3/4 cup mini semi-sweet chocolate chips
- Flaky sea salt for topping
Instructions
- Cream the softened butter using a mixer until smooth. Add sugars and blend well. Mix in vanilla and eggs until combined.
- Gradually add dry ingredients until a dough forms, then fold in chocolate chips.
- Scoop dough into balls (about 140 grams each) and chill for at least 3 hours.
-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Bake cookies for 12–16 minutes until slightly underdone in the center.
- Allow cookies to cool on the baking sheet for about five minutes before enjoying.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 15 minutes
